Obituary for Linda Lou McDermott (Mayhew)

We gave Linda back on December 4 in the hospice in Squamish, BC. She had been in hospital for a month with pneumonia and heart attack. During the last three years she had become progressively weak and bedridden at home. Linda was a family physician in Haileybury, a nursing home physician and director of the women’s shelter. She led girl Guides. She used her energy in the horse club and the fall fair. She was active in third world development travelling to Honduras, Guatemala, India, Sri lanka and the Phillippines. Those who knew her understand the inadequacy of this list. There was usually an extra teenager staying at the farm and occasionally a family. “Linda’s girls” were welcome in the barn to ride and learn horsemanship. Her love was shared by Tom and sons Dan,Gavin (spouse Jackie) and Henry (spouse Sabrina); as well as sister Jean Ann Cooney, brothers Rick and Ed Mayhew. She lived this life to the fullest and now exhausted was ready to move on. Her ashes will be
buried at the family home in Mount Currie BC. No funeral no flowers. Contributions to International development through World Accord (http://www.worldaccord.org/ would be welcomed. Smile at a stranger today and hug a friend-that was Linda’s way.
